diff options
author | Jon Bratseth <bratseth@oath.com> | 2018-06-11 09:37:20 +0200 |
---|---|---|
committer | Jon Bratseth <bratseth@oath.com> | 2018-06-11 09:37:20 +0200 |
commit | f87e1c4f6ead9ad0fe8a7c4c405206d00ab10b61 (patch) | |
tree | 57c226823a3821aff0c69a587edda57ff8d30efd | |
parent | e06df4061aee4f10adad54a52f19092c13b72fef (diff) |
Add temporary logging
5 files changed, 9 insertions, 7 deletions
diff --git a/config/src/main/java/com/yahoo/config/subscription/ConfigSubscriber.java b/config/src/main/java/com/yahoo/config/subscription/ConfigSubscriber.java index 47048fa16c7..5c296c3e1a6 100644 --- a/config/src/main/java/com/yahoo/config/subscription/ConfigSubscriber.java +++ b/config/src/main/java/com/yahoo/config/subscription/ConfigSubscriber.java @@ -267,6 +267,7 @@ public class ConfigSubscriber { // This indicates the clients will possibly reconfigure their services, so "reset" changed-logic in subscriptions. // Also if appropriate update the changed flag on the handler, which clients use. markSubsChangedSeen(currentGen); + Logger.getLogger("REDEPLOY").info("ConfigSubscriber.acquireSnapshot: Received config generation " + generation + " with internalRedeploy=" + internalRedeployOnly); internalRedeploy = internalRedeployOnly; generation = currentGen; } diff --git a/configserver/src/main/java/com/yahoo/vespa/config/server/modelfactory/ActivatedModelsBuilder.java b/configserver/src/main/java/com/yahoo/vespa/config/server/modelfactory/ActivatedModelsBuilder.java index d83548dcc3d..12ad1efed83 100644 --- a/configserver/src/main/java/com/yahoo/vespa/config/server/modelfactory/ActivatedModelsBuilder.java +++ b/configserver/src/main/java/com/yahoo/vespa/config/server/modelfactory/ActivatedModelsBuilder.java @@ -88,6 +88,7 @@ public class ActivatedModelsBuilder extends ModelsBuilder<Application> { new com.yahoo.component.Version(modelFactory.getVersion().toString()), wantedNodeVespaVersion); MetricUpdater applicationMetricUpdater = metrics.getOrCreateMetricUpdater(Metrics.createDimensions(applicationId)); + Logger.getLogger("REDEPLOY").info("ApplicationModelsBuilder.buildModelVersion: " + applicationId + " generation " + appGeneration + " created with internalRedeploy=" + applicationPackage.getMetaData().isInternalRedeploy()); return new Application(modelFactory.createModel(modelContext), cache, appGeneration, applicationPackage.getMetaData().isInternalRedeploy(), modelFactory.getVersion(), diff --git a/configserver/src/main/java/com/yahoo/vespa/config/server/rpc/ConfigResponseFactory.java b/configserver/src/main/java/com/yahoo/vespa/config/server/rpc/ConfigResponseFactory.java index 247ae388639..2a385a15fb6 100644 --- a/configserver/src/main/java/com/yahoo/vespa/config/server/rpc/ConfigResponseFactory.java +++ b/configserver/src/main/java/com/yahoo/vespa/config/server/rpc/ConfigResponseFactory.java @@ -19,9 +19,9 @@ public interface ConfigResponseFactory { * @param payload The {@link com.yahoo.vespa.config.ConfigPayload} to put in the response. * @param defFile The {@link com.yahoo.config.codegen.InnerCNode} def file for this config. * @param generation The payload generation. @return A {@link ConfigResponse} that can be sent to the client. - * @param internalRedeployment whether this config generation was produced by an internal redeployment, - * not a change to the application package + * @param internalRedeploy whether this config generation was produced by an internal redeployment, + * not a change to the application package */ - ConfigResponse createResponse(ConfigPayload payload, InnerCNode defFile, long generation, boolean internalRedeployment); + ConfigResponse createResponse(ConfigPayload payload, InnerCNode defFile, long generation, boolean internalRedeploy); } diff --git a/configserver/src/main/java/com/yahoo/vespa/config/server/rpc/LZ4ConfigResponseFactory.java b/configserver/src/main/java/com/yahoo/vespa/config/server/rpc/LZ4ConfigResponseFactory.java index ff15eb7bfa7..dcbc21e536c 100644 --- a/configserver/src/main/java/com/yahoo/vespa/config/server/rpc/LZ4ConfigResponseFactory.java +++ b/configserver/src/main/java/com/yahoo/vespa/config/server/rpc/LZ4ConfigResponseFactory.java @@ -24,12 +24,12 @@ public class LZ4ConfigResponseFactory implements ConfigResponseFactory { public ConfigResponse createResponse(ConfigPayload payload, InnerCNode defFile, long generation, - boolean internalRedeployment) { + boolean internalRedeploy) { Utf8Array rawPayload = payload.toUtf8Array(true); String configMd5 = ConfigUtils.getMd5(rawPayload); CompressionInfo info = CompressionInfo.create(CompressionType.LZ4, rawPayload.getByteLength()); Utf8Array compressed = new Utf8Array(compressor.compress(rawPayload.getBytes())); - return new SlimeConfigResponse(compressed, defFile, generation, internalRedeployment, configMd5, info); + return new SlimeConfigResponse(compressed, defFile, generation, internalRedeploy, configMd5, info); } } diff --git a/configserver/src/main/java/com/yahoo/vespa/config/server/rpc/UncompressedConfigResponseFactory.java b/configserver/src/main/java/com/yahoo/vespa/config/server/rpc/UncompressedConfigResponseFactory.java index 995e981e0f3..91809f90a70 100644 --- a/configserver/src/main/java/com/yahoo/vespa/config/server/rpc/UncompressedConfigResponseFactory.java +++ b/configserver/src/main/java/com/yahoo/vespa/config/server/rpc/UncompressedConfigResponseFactory.java @@ -21,11 +21,11 @@ public class UncompressedConfigResponseFactory implements ConfigResponseFactory public ConfigResponse createResponse(ConfigPayload payload, InnerCNode defFile, long generation, - boolean internalRedeployment) { + boolean internalRedeploy) { Utf8Array rawPayload = payload.toUtf8Array(true); String configMd5 = ConfigUtils.getMd5(rawPayload); CompressionInfo info = CompressionInfo.create(CompressionType.UNCOMPRESSED, rawPayload.getByteLength()); - return new SlimeConfigResponse(rawPayload, defFile, generation, internalRedeployment, configMd5, info); + return new SlimeConfigResponse(rawPayload, defFile, generation, internalRedeploy, configMd5, info); } } |